Synopsis
" Lily and the Octopus is the dog book you must read this summer...a profound experience." -- The Washington Post Combining the emotional depth of The Art of Racing in the Rain with the magical spirit of The Life of Pi , Lily and the Octopus is an epic adventure of the heart. When you sit down with Lily and the Octopus , you will be taken on an unforgettable ride. The magic of this novel is in the read, and we don't want to spoil it by giving away too many details. We can tell you that this is a story about that special someone: the one you trust, the one you can't live without. For Ted Flask, that someone special is his aging companion Lily, who happens to be a dog. Lily and the Octopus reminds us how it feels to love fiercely, how difficult it can be to let go, and how the fight for those we love is the greatest fight of all.     • Lily and the Octopus

      It is a bittersweet story for anyone who has loved, lost, and then found love again. For those of us who also know the unconditional love of our dog mates it takes us through all the emotions experienced from time of joyful adoption to the deep pain in walking them across the bridge as we let them go. Like Ted, we all have one soul dog in our lives that alters us for the rest of time. I loved the book!
